Hello and thanks for reading this -
I have just bought an newage STI intercooler and i plan on fitting this to my newage WRX.
Whilst I appreciate this may be a boring subject and there has probably been many threads along the same lines, I have no idea what is involved.
If anyone can allaborate on what i need to buy and do it would be much appreciated. Will The STI TMIC simply just install to where the WRX TMIC was with the WRX Y-Pipe?

yes mate wil swap right over, the tubo pipe will be a tad too big on the intercooler to the turbo as wrx has baby turbo, so make sure u use a decent jubilee clip and make it nice and tight,
other than that happy days

Only tip is to loosen the brackets on the block when you refit the TMIC and then tighten as you may need the little bit of play this allows to fit the STi one snuggly. Also you need the scoop and undertray to get the most out of it.
Definitely get the undertray, to make sure the air is directed over the larger surface. Not much benefit to the sti intercooler if the wrx undertray only pushes air over the same surface area as it did before. Worth getting a samco y pipe at the same time?

What I was trying to link to was a post about the undertray...
I modified my 03 tray. Essentially, I got an sti undertray, cut it up so that I only had the bottom part. Then I cut off the top (scoop part) of my old undertray and pop riveted them together.
That way, I ended up with an undertray that covers the intercooler *and* fits into the scoop.
If you just get the STI undertray on its own, you also need an STI scoop for the tray to fit.
